About Clarkton

Clarkton, North Carolina is home to 1 public schools, with combined enrollment of approximately 147 students. By school count, it is a low-population city.

Average school size in Clarkton is around 147 students, 74% noticeably below the North Carolina average of about 571.

Over the past 7-year window. Across the same 7-year window, public-school enrollment shrank 62%: 391 students in SY 2017-18 versus 147 in SY 2024-25. Over that span, Clarkton shed 1 school, going from 2 to 1.
